The Ashworth College correspondence course in floral design will prepare you for a dynamic career in a creative
atmosphere. Unlike traditional, professional flower arranging courses, Ashworth College allows you to learn at home and at your own pace, following a complete, well designed course of material including:
- Balance, proportion and scale
- Care and handling of flowers and plants
- Composition, harmony and unity
- Contemporary design and techniques
- Floral nomenclature
- Focal point and rhythm
- Line, form, space and depth
- Oriental design style
- Post harvest physiology
- Special and seasonal occasions and holidays
- Study of color
- Texture and fragrance
